
Follow every race that matters—from local contests to statewide primaries. Get live results, in-depth candidate profiles, and expert analysis all in one place.
Stoney asked his supporters to back state Sen. Ghazala Hashmi for lieutenant governor.
Spotlight on VPM Original Content
Virginia News
NPR News
Virginia News
-
At a federal prison in rural Virginia, more than 50 prisoners say they've been abused. But when they try to file a complaint — they're stopped, often by the same guards they say are abusing them.
-
Partner company hopes to have the project up and running by the 2030s.
-
The president-elect said the process would be "easy," but the path could be far murkier.
-
State surplus above estimates would go toward education, disaster relief.
-
Richmond Commonwealth’s Attorney didn’t rule out future charges.
-
A 2018 study estimated it would cost $22M to fix, replace aged parts.
NPR News
-
The FCC has delayed implementing its multilingual emergency alerts system — making non-English speakers vulnerable during climate disasters.
-
Israel's conflict with Iran is pushing its war in Gaza to the periphery. But Palestinians there are still being killed and are under a near-total blockade.
-
North Korea sent 11,000 elite soldiers to support Russia. Their progress — especially in drone warfare — has implications not only for Russia's war on Ukraine but also peace on the Korean Peninsula.
-
NPR speaks with a student from Myanmar who fears his plans to attend graduate school in the U.S. could be derailed by the administration's newest travel ban.
-
The federal judge in the case says she hopes to decide next week on whether to block indefinitely President Trump's June 4th order on Harvard's international students.
Listen to VPM
- VPM Daily Newscast: Spanberger–Hashmi–Jones vs. Earle-Sears, Reid and Miyares
- VPM Daily Newscast: Data centers, ranked choice voting
- VPM Daily Newscast: the HD-81 primary, VDH and the City of Richmond
- BizSense Beat: Henrico data centers, Lego in Short Pump, electric vehicle retailer expands